Walk the Walk: Burberry Prorsum S/S 2012 Menswear Collection

A very nice collection with a retro flare.

Christopher Bailey has just presented the S/S 2012 menswear collection titled Handcrafted Heritage. One of the most amazing things about this collection is black is missing, and tit is replaced by different vibrant colors. The patterns on the clothes this seasons are amazing, especially the circular graphic. Because of the patterns, they somehow injects a retro flare to the collection (I keep thinking about the Beatles for some reasons). Also, the accessories are killers and I think I will want to have those shoes in my wardrobe next season. Bravo, this is a very interesting, yet wearable collection.

Pros:
- A very colorful collection with lots of bright colors.
- Good use of the patterns.
- I love the embellishments on the white shirts and the wood geometric shapes on the sweaters.
- The knit collar design on some of the pieces are simply amazing.
- The accessories are amazing. The soles of the shoes are made of Cork!

Cons:
- The oversized pieces do not really work for me. To me, trench coat will always look good when it is in slim cut.
